Output a8b60fd4f14f20439a8e774934c8465a7bc52e89d999c87dbb342bdd39a21e50:0

value
6785995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ec03f23f616904c7dcffdeb1ecf07a1c881aa8d6 OP_EQUAL
address
3PCx81RKjURLmCT91Wxi11j6Q1rfErW1eK
transaction
a8b60fd4f14f20439a8e774934c8465a7bc52e89d999c87dbb342bdd39a21e50
confirmations
281581
spent
true